the only other gotcha (and it is occasional) is if your branch structure is "non-standard" in which case you'd need to configure the tagBase option inthe maven-release-plugin
However that is rather rare -Stephen On 10 March 2010 17:48, Kalle Korhonen <[email protected]> wrote: > You don't need any command line options to release from a branch (I'd > even go so far as to say that if you need to specify command line > options with mvn release, you haven't configured the plugin correctly) > but you *have to* have scm urls pointing to the right location (i.e. > not the trunk for the branched versioned). If you created the branch > using mvn release:branch, it would manage the scm element for you > (again, assuming you've configured the plugin properly in the first > place). We do all of our point/bug fix releases from branches. > > Kalle > > > On Wed, Mar 10, 2010 at 8:51 AM, Steven Hilton <[email protected]> > wrote: > > Greetings, > > > > Can the maven release plugin build a tag from a branch during a > > release:prepare?
